Defiant Development announced that its piece of additional content for the hybrid of deckbuilder, roguelike, and action RPG Hand of Fate 2 will arrive today for PC. The update will add major character the Dealer as a companion character, who will become available after completing the game's final challenge. Like other forthcoming add-ons, it will also be released in 2018 for PlayStation 4 and Xbox One.
A sequel to 2015's Hand of Fate, Hand of Fate 2 once again sees players taking on the challenge of the dealer, where cards determine what encounters they have to deal with, which can come in the form of decisions or real-time combat. The game was originally released for PC and PlayStation 4 in November 2017 and for Xbox One in December 2017.
